MITCHELL v. CLARK EQUIPMENT CO.

No. 89-CA-731.

561 So.2d 175 (1990)

Anthony P. MITCHELL v. CLARK EQUIPMENT COMPANY, et al.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, Fifth Circuit.

April 11, 1990.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Patrick D. McArdle, Laura E. Fahy, McArdle and Fahy, New Orleans, for plaintiff/appellee.

J. Mark Graham, Henderson, Hanemann & Morris, Houma, for defendants/appellants.

Janice B. Unland, Metairie, for intervenors/appellants.

Before GAUDIN, WICKER, and GOTHARD, JJ.


GOTHARD, Judge.

This suit arises from an accident on November 16, 1985, in which a worker was injured when a forklift he was driving overturned and landed on top of him.

The plaintiff, Anthony Mitchell, sued Clark Equipment Company, manufacturer of the forklift, and W.W. Clarklift, local distributor for the forklift. Mitchell's employer, Witco Chemical Corporation, and its insurer, Home Insurance Company, intervened for worker's compensation benefits paid...
